Job Description

The Clinical Research Supervisor oversees the conduct of industry-sponsored and investigator-initiated clinical trials in accordance with trial protocols, FDA regulations, and ICH/GCP guidelines. This role entails functioning as a clinical study coordinator when necessary and involves training, mentoring, and developing the clinical study coordinators and research staff. The supervisor works closely with managers and leaders to facilitate the initiation through completion of clinical research studies in assigned areas, provides day-to-day supervision, and conducts ongoing performance reviews of clinical research staff at the department level. Key responsibilities include supervising clinical research team activities, ensuring quality and safety of clinical operations, and collaborating with various internal and external partners to optimize workflow and resource allocation.

Certification: Certified Clinical Research Coordinator (CCRC) (per the Association of Clinical Research Professionals (ACRP) or Society of Clinical Research Associates (SOCRA) is a requirement for the role.
